Sale

Practical Network Automation Leverage the power of Python and Ansible to optimize your network-Packt Publishing (2017)

Original price was: $35.00.Current price is: $0.00.

GOLD Membership – Just $49 for 31 Days
Get unlimited downloads. To purchase a subscription, click here. Gold Membership

Description

 

Practical Network Automation – Leverage the Power of Python and Ansible

Practical Network Automation with Python and Ansible is a hands-on course designed to help network engineers automate repetitive networking tasks and manage modern infrastructures efficiently. In today’s fast-paced IT environments, automation has become essential for maintaining scalable and reliable networks. This course from Packt Publishing (2017) teaches you how to use Python scripting and Ansible automation tools to simplify network configuration, monitoring, and deployment. By combining programming skills with network engineering knowledge, you will learn how to reduce manual errors, save time, and improve operational efficiency across your network infrastructure.

What You’ll Learn

  • Understand the fundamentals of network automation and why it is critical in modern IT environments
  • Use Python to automate common networking tasks and workflows
  • Write scripts to manage network devices and configurations
  • Learn how to use Ansible for agentless automation across multiple devices
  • Automate network configuration management and deployments
  • Integrate Python with networking libraries and APIs
  • Build repeatable automation workflows to simplify network administration
  • Implement best practices for scalable network automation

Requirements

  • Basic understanding of networking concepts (routing, switching, TCP/IP)
  • Fundamental knowledge of Linux or command-line environments
  • Basic familiarity with Python programming is helpful but not mandatory
  • A computer capable of running Python and Ansible tools

Description: Practical Network Automation

Modern networks are becoming increasingly complex, and manual configuration of devices is no longer efficient. Practical Network Automation introduces network engineers and IT professionals to automation techniques using Python and Ansible. These tools allow you to automate repetitive tasks such as device configuration, network monitoring, and deployment management.

The course begins by introducing the principles of network automation and demonstrating how Python can interact with network devices. You will learn how to write automation scripts that connect to routers and switches, retrieve information, and configure devices automatically. Python libraries designed for network engineers will also be introduced to simplify automation workflows.

Next, the course explores Ansible, a powerful agentless automation tool widely used in modern DevOps and network automation environments. You will learn how to create playbooks, manage network configurations, and automate multi-device operations using Ansible. By the end of the course, you will be able to build scalable automation workflows that improve reliability and reduce human errors in network management.

This course is ideal for network engineers who want to transition into network automation and DevOps practices. Learning Python and Ansible together provides a powerful combination that allows you to automate tasks, manage large infrastructures, and increase productivity in enterprise networking environments.

Who This Course Is For

  • Network engineers looking to automate routine networking tasks
  • System administrators interested in network automation tools
  • IT professionals who want to learn Python for networking
  • DevOps engineers managing network infrastructure
  • Students preparing for modern networking and automation careers

Explore These Valuable Resources

Explore Related Courses

Reviews

There are no reviews yet.

Only logged in customers who have purchased this product may leave a review.